Abstract
The utility model belongs to technical field of lamps, and in particular to a kind of high-low beam integrated light tool.A variety of incomplete reflecting mirrors are used for the bis- optical lens lamps of existing projection-type LED, the lower deficiency of light utilization efficiency, the utility model adopts the following technical solution: a kind of high-low beam integrated light tool, including lamp holder, lamp holder front end is equipped with optical lens, wiring board is additionally provided on lamp holder, wiring board is equipped with lamp bead group, lamp bead group includes at least one set of dipped beam LED lamp bead and at least one set of distance light LED lamp bead, the wiring board is equipped with a projection Lamp cup, the projection Lamp cup is between wiring board and optical lens, when high-beam condition, the light that entire projection Lamp cup issues distance light LED lamp bead reflects, when dipped beam state, the light that entire projection Lamp cup issues dipped beam LED lamp bead reflects.The beneficial effects of the utility model are: entirely projection Lamp cup reflects dipped beam and distance light light, light efficiency utilization rate is improved, and hot spot depth is longer, and better effect is shone on road.

Technical field
The utility model belongs to technical field of lamps, and in particular to a kind of high-low beam integrated light tool.
Background technique
Double optical lens for motorcycle or electric vehicle currently on the market, be all largely by solenoid valve control baffle come
Realize darkening, cost is higher, and structure is complex, and installation accuracy is more demanding, and solenoid valve is easily damaged.
To omit solenoid valve, there is the alternative solution using multiple groups LED: using dipped beam LED and distance light LED at least two groups
LED, light shine directly on lens, bright or go out and realize distance light and dipped beam by controlling different LED.This class formation, using more
Kind reflecting mirror, each reflecting mirror are incomplete circular cone, and reflective surface area is smaller, and light efficiency is lower, and overall utilization can only achieve LED and shine
50% or so of efficiency, and the process and assemble of multiple Lamp cups is also relatively complicated.
Summary of the invention
The utility model uses a variety of incomplete reflecting mirrors, light utilization efficiency for the bis- optical lens lamps of existing projection-type LED
Lower deficiency provides a kind of high-low beam integrated light tool, effectively improves light utilization efficiency.
